Join Gefsky Community Scholar Rabbi Danny Schiff for a powerful conversation with Sarah Hurwitz, former speechwriter for Barack and Michelle Obama and Hillary Clinton, as she shares insights from her bold new book, As a Jew: Reclaiming Our Story from Those Who Blame, Shame and Try to Erase Us (coming September 2025). In this deeply personal work, Hurwitz explores her journey back to Judaism—confronting antisemitism, rediscovering Jewish wisdom and embracing her heritage with pride.

Sarah Hurwitz is the author of Here All Along: Finding Meaning, Spirituality, and a Deeper Connection to Life – in Judaism (After Finally Choosing to Look There)—which was a finalist for two National Jewish Book Awards and for the Sami Rohr Prize for Jewish Literature—and of As a Jew: Reclaiming Our Story From Those Who Shame, Blame, and Try To Erase Us, which won the Natan Notable Book Award. She was a White House speechwriter from 2009 to 2017, starting out as a senior speechwriter for President Barack Obama and then serving as head speechwriter for First Lady Michelle Obama. Prior to working in the White House, Hurwitz was the chief speechwriter for Hillary Clinton on her 2008 presidential campaign. Hurwitz is a graduate of Harvard College and Harvard Law School and has completed training to be a chaplain, which she does on a volunteer basis at a hospital near her home.
